Abstract:
The present invention provides a method for surface-modifying a rubber vulcanizate or a thermoplastic elastomer, which can cost-effectively provide a variety of functions, such as remarkable sliding properties or biocompatibility, according to the application. The present invention relates to a method for surface-modifying a rubber vulcanizate or a thermoplastic elastomer as a modification target, the method including: step 1 of forming polymerization initiation points A on a surface of the modification target; step 2 of radically polymerizing a non-functional monomer starting from the polymerization initiation points A to grow non-functional polymer chains; step 3 of washing the modification target on which the non-functional polymer chains are grown; step 4 of forming polymerization initiation points B on a surface of the non-functional polymer chains; and step 5 of radically polymerizing a fluorine-containing functional monomer starting from the polymerization initiation points B to grow fluorine-containing functional polymer chains.
Abstract:
The tire tread has a ground-contact surface and a main groove, secondary grooves; and blocks. The blocks are each provided with an upper surface, front-surface side walls, side-surface side walls, front-surface edges formed in positions where the upper surface intersects the front-surface side walls and side-surface edges formed in positions where the upper surface intersects the side-surface side walls. The blocks each have a reinforcement section with an average thickness of t and an elastic modulus (Ef) higher than the elastic modulus (Et) of a rubber composition forming the tread. An undulating section with ridge sections and a valley section is formed in the front-surface side wall. The undulating section is provided so as to form at least a portion of the at least one front-surface side wall having the reinforcement section provided thereto, and so as to form at least a portion of the reinforcement section.
Abstract:
The present invention aims to provide a method for modifying a surface of a rubber vulcanizate or a thermoplastic elastomer, which can impart excellent sliding properties and excellent durability against repeated sliding motion, and allow the surface to maintain the sealing properties, without using expensive self-lubricating resins. The present invention relates to a method for modifying a surface of an object of a rubber vulcanizate or a thermoplastic elastomer, the method including: Step 1 of forming polymerization initiation points on the surface of the object; and Step 2 of radical-polymerizing a monomer starting from the polymerization initiation points to grow polymer chains on the surface of the object.

Abstract:
A pneumatic tire tread in which a reinforcing part is provided on frontal side walls of a block of a tire tread in order to improve the performance on snow and the performance on ice, and a pneumatic tire having such a tread, wherein angles T1 and T2 formed by the upper surface and the two frontal side walls provided with the reinforcing part are both less than 90°.

Abstract:
A tread made of rubber-like material for a tire for winter travelhaving a plurality of blocks of a height H, each block comprising a contact face designed to come into contact with the ground when the tire travels and at least one lateral face, said lateral face being covered by a layer of covering material over at least 50% of the surface thereof, and a leading zone designed to come into contact first with the ground when the tire travels, and said block has an oblique direction of extension (J) such that the leading zone of said block is a leading corner, and a part which is not covered by the covering material, said covering material having a modulus of elasticity which is greater than the modulus of elasticity of the rubber-like material forming the block, said uncovered part extending from the leading corner over at least 1/3 of the height H of the block.

Abstract:
The invention relates to pneumatic tires having treads of a cap/base configuration where the outer tread cap rubber layer contains lugs with intervening grooves which extend to the running surface of the tread cap and wherein at least one of said grooves is contained in a rubber block within the tread. For this invention, the tread groove-containing rubber block is an extension of the tread base rubber layer which extends radially outward into the outer tread cap rubber layer.
Abstract:
The invention provides a pneumatic tire which can reduce a rolling resistance while maintaining an wear resistance. Among a cap portion in a center area, at least the cap portion of a center land portion is provided with a cap front layer which includes a surface, and a cap inner layer which is laminated in an inner periphery of the cap front layer. A loss tangent of the cap front layer is set to be smaller than a loss tangent of the cap inner layer and be smaller than a loss tangent of the cap portions in the shoulder areas.
Abstract:
A tire includes a circumferential tread constructed of a base material. The circumferential tread has a plurality of tread elements, with each of the plurality of tread elements having a top surface and a plurality of side surfaces. The circumferential tread further has a plurality of grooves disposed between the plurality of tread elements. A laminate covers at least some of the plurality of tread elements and at least some of the plurality of grooves. The laminate has greater snow traction than the base material.
